Study hard
Studying hard, a Chinese idiom, Pinyin is y á NJ ī NGK ǔ s ī, which means careful study and deep thinking. It comes from a book written by Liu Gong.

The origin of Idioms
Wang Ling of the Song Dynasty said in his reply to the book written by Duke Liu: "study hard, find the gap and find the door."
Idiom usage
It means to study carefully and think deeply.
